Transaction 3151f731f12acc3313150261068f03e6873717910d9acbdd0b10704b2642fb85
1 Input
1 Output
-
3151f731f12acc3313150261068f03e6873717910d9acbdd0b10704b2642fb85:0
- value
- 369825516
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7f87c0781a695b947ee5f94d2aaebbdeb34a116
- address
- bc1q5lu8cpup562mj3lwt72d92hthh4nfggkkzs8z0